Hydro One is proud to be the largest electricity transmission and distribution provider in Ontario, serving nearly 1.5 million customers. We have a long history in the industry with our roots dating back over 110 years to 1906. Since then, we have worked to grow and evolve to meet the changing needs of our customers and communities across Ontario. Today, we’re focused on providing exceptional customer service and ensuring we are building safe communities where we live, work and play.

General Accountabilities

- Assist in the Application Readiness/Assessment phase of the Windows 11 Migration Project

- Assist in ongoing project management support of the Windows 11 Application Readiness Project

- Assist in creating reports, dashboards, and other visualizations to clearly articulate progress, statuses, and risks.

- Communicate with internal teams, peers, and 3rd party vendors to obtain concise information with respect to Windows 11 readiness of over 800 applications.

- Assist in the creation and modification of department processes.

- Receive assignments from supervisors on problems related to assigned area of work.

- Research available resources and contacts required to perform the necessary analysis and propose effective recommendations.

- Work with others, including different team managers and senior staff as required.

- Assist in managing and tracking projects statuses, report on variances.

- Assist in driving project success through timely update requests.

- Perform other duties as required.
